Output 41bc32ce895a8fcf635003c95b856db830e76833f5d124134be7eb38baba0c8d:1

value
23650681
script pubkey
OP_0 OP_PUSHBYTES_20 79cde679080939c0606408e73aa6408532645202
address
bc1q08x7v7ggpyuuqcryprnn4fjqs5exg5sz78pftg
transaction
41bc32ce895a8fcf635003c95b856db830e76833f5d124134be7eb38baba0c8d
confirmations
169588
spent
true